Eventually, recognizing the value of normal sewage system cleansing is essential for preserving a risk-free and reliable pipes system.Typical Causes of Clogged Sewage System Lines

Obstructed drain lines can commonly be traced back to a couple of usual reasons. Grease buildup from cooking waste and other materials can build up over time, obstructing circulation. Furthermore, tree origin intrusion postures a considerable danger, as origins seek dampness and can penetrate drain systems, causing blockages.
Grease Build-up Issues
When oil accumulates in sewer lines, it usually causes considerable pipes concerns. Oil accumulation, mainly from cooking fats, oils, and food scraps, can develop blockages that restrict water flow. Over time, this hardened deposit complies with the inner walls of pipelines, forming a sludge-like mass that traps added particles. As the obstruction worsens, pressure develops within the system, which can cause slow drain and undesirable odors. Home owners often undervalue the impact of incorrect disposal techniques, such as pouring grease down the sink. Routine sewage system cleaning is vital to alleviate these troubles, permitting the removal of grease and avoiding pricey emergencies. Resolving grease buildup without delay can conserve home owners from extensive repair work and disruptions.Tree Root Breach
Tree origin breach is a common yet typically ignored source of clogged drain lines, as roots naturally look for moisture and nutrients from the dirt. When tree roots run into sewage system lines, they can infiltrate joints and fractures, resulting in clogs. This intrusion not just obstructs the circulation of wastewater yet can additionally create substantial damage to the pipelines, leading to expensive repair work. Trees are generally drawn to old or damaged pipelines, making normal upkeep essential. Homeowners might stay unaware of root problems until back-ups occur, highlighting the importance of aggressive sewage system cleaning and evaluations. How can home owners recognize prospective concerns with their drain lines? Numerous indications may suggest that attention is required. One usual symptom is slow-moving drain; if numerous fixtures are draining slowly, it could represent a clog in the drain line. House owners need to additionally look out to unusual odors, particularly sewer smells, which might show a leak or backup. In addition, the visibility of gurgling sounds in the plumbing can recommend air entraped in the pipelines as a result of a clog. An additional advising indicator is persistent wet spots or lush spots of lawn in the yard, which might indicate a sewage system leakage. Constant backups in bathrooms or drains are a clear indication that sewage system lines need instant focus. Identifying these indicators early can help home owners avoid extra severe pipes concerns down the line and maintain a healthy sewer system.The Repercussions of Neglecting Sewage System Maintenance
